Payroll Assistant - APAC

The Payroll Assistant will play a vital role in supporting our APAC payroll operations, ensuring that all processes run smoothly and efficiently. This position involves managing various payroll tasks, collaborating with team members, and addressing any issues that may arise, all while maintaining a high standard of accuracy and compliance with relevant regulations.

What you’ll do:
  • Payroll Administration: Handle all internal payroll tasks using Roubler, making sure everything is accurate and complies with APAC regulations, with a specific focus in Australia.
  • Stakeholder Management: Build relationships with key stakeholders to keep payroll processes seamless and address any issues that come up.
  • Liaison with Outsourced Provider: Serve as the main point of contact for our outsourced payroll provider, coordinating necessary information and resolving any concerns.
  • Respond to Queries: Answer payroll-related questions from employees, providing clear and helpful information.
  • Flexi Purchase & Credit Card Management: Oversee flexi purchases and credit card transactions for the APAC region.
  • Collaboration: Work closely with team members to ensure an efficient payroll operation.
You’ll be someone who can bring:
  • Minimum 3 years of experience in payroll administration or related roles, ideally within an RPO, BPO, or professional services environment.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Attention to detail and the ability to manage deadlines and changing priorities.
  • Familiarity with Roubler or similar payroll systems is a plus.
  • A collaborative and proactive approach to work.
  • Knowledge of Australian / other APAC regions payroll processes.
